Steffi Graf Autographs
Steffi Graf, widely regarded as one of the greatest female tennis players in history, was born on June 14, 1969, in Mannheim, West Germany. Graf began playing tennis at a young age, showing prodigious talent that quickly set her apart from her peers. By the age of 13, she turned professional, and her remarkable work ethic and competitive spirit soon catapulted her into the upper echelons of the sport. With her powerful forehand and exceptional footwork, Graf rapidly rose through the ranks, earning her first Grand Slam title at the French Open in 1987, when she was just 17 years old.
Throughout her illustrious career, spanning from the mid-1980s to the late 1990s, Graf dominated women's tennis with an impressive array of achievements. She won 22 Grand Slam singles titles, the most of any female player until Serena Williams surpassed her in 2017. Graf's iconic 1988 season was particularly noteworthy, as she became the only player in history to achieve a "Golden Slam" by winning all four major championships—the Australian Open, the French Open, Wimbledon, and the US Open—along with the Olympic gold medal in a single calendar year. Her exceptional talent, combined with her intense focus and professionalism, set new standards in the sport and ushered in a new era of competitive women's tennis.
Graf's impact on tennis extended beyond her on-court success; she was known for her sportsmanship and is often celebrated for her humility. After retiring in 1999, she left a lasting legacy, inspiring countless young athletes, especially women, to pursue tennis. Graf's contributions to the game were recognized when she was inducted into the International Tennis Hall of Fame in 2004. Even today, her powerful legacy continues to resonate, as she remains an influential figure in the world of sports, championing athletes and engaging in charitable endeavors, further solidifying her status as a true ambassador for tennis.
